Output 803da210354276261922b625afda19e08b8f5c61fcc12aab1fd5ae1926374361:1

value
67720229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3affbb0372c917caa269bd98d836aa4df108eeff OP_EQUAL
address
374yU8xdtWkygLbAHkNzXrLJHaDHoiQ8n5
transaction
803da210354276261922b625afda19e08b8f5c61fcc12aab1fd5ae1926374361
spent
true